    Transitive Packing: A Unifying Concept in Combinatorial Optimization

    Get PDF
    This paper attempts to give a better understanding of the facial structure of previously separately investigated polyhedra. It introduces the notion of transitive packing and the transitive packing polytope. Polytopes that turn out to be special cases of the transitive packing polytope are, among others, the node packing polytope, the acyclic subdigraph polytope, the bipartite subgraph polytope, the planar subgraph polytope, the clique partitioning polytope, the partition polytope, the transitive acyclic subdigraph polytope, the interval order polytope, and the relatively transitive subgraph polytope. We give cutting plane proofs for several rich classes of valid inequalities of the transitive packing polytope,in this way introducing generalized cycle, generalized clique, generalized antihole, generalized antiweb, and odd partition inequalities. These classes subsume several known classes of valid inequalities for several of the special cases and give also many new inequalities for several other special cases. For some of the classes we also prove a lower bound for their Gomory-Chvdtal rank. Finally, we relate the concept of transitive packing to generalized (set) packing and covering as well as to balanced and ideal matrices

    Combined Effects of Knowledge About Others' Opinions and Anticipation of Group Discussion on Confirmatory Information Search

    Get PDF
    There is conclusive evidence that information search processes are typically biased in favor of the information seeker’s own opinion (confirmation bias). Less is known about how knowledge about others’ opinions affects this confirmatory information search. In the present study, the authors manipulated feedback about others’ opinions and anticipation of group interaction. As predicted, the effect of knowledge about others’ opinions on confirmatory information search depended on whether participants anticipated interacting with these others. Specifically, minority members anticipating a group discussion exhibited a particularly strong confirmation bias, whereas minority members who did not anticipate a discussion predominantly sought information opposing their opinion. For participants not anticipating group interaction, confidence about the correctness of one’s decision mediated the impact of knowledge about others’ opinions on confirmatory information search. Results are discussed with regard to the debiasing effect of preference heterogeneity on confirmatory information search in groups

    Beyond group-level explanations for the failure of groups to solve hidden profiles: The individual preference effect revisited

    Get PDF
    The individual preference effect supplements the predominant group-level explanations for the failure of groups to solve hidden profiles. Even in the absence of dysfunctional group-level processes, group members tend to stick to their suboptimal initial decision preferences due to preference-consistent evaluation of information. However, previous experiments demonstrating this effect retained two group-level processes, namely (a) social validation of information supporting the group members’ initial preferences and (b) presentation of the additional information in a discussion format. Therefore, it was unclear whether the individual preference effect depends on the co-occurrence of these group-level processes. Here, we report two experiments demonstrating that the individual preference effect is indeed an individual-level phenomenon. Moreover, by a comparison to real interacting groups, we can show that even when all relevant information is exchanged and when no coordination losses occur, almost half of all groups would fail to solve hidden profiles due to the individual preference effect

    Biased Information Search in Homogeneous Groups: Confidence as a Moderator for the Effect of Anticipated Task Requirements

    Get PDF
    When searching for information, groups that are homogeneous regarding their members’ prediscussion decision preferences show a strong bias for information that supports rather than conflicts with the prevailing opinion (confirmation bias). The present research examined whether homogeneous groups blindly search for information confirming their beliefs irrespective of the anticipated task or whether they are sensitive to the usefulness of new information for this forthcoming task. Results of three experiments show that task sensitivity depends on the groups’ confidence in the correctness of their decision: Moderately confident groups displayed a strong confirmation bias when they anticipated having to give reasons for their decision but showed a balanced information search or even a disconfirmation bias (i.e., predominately seeking conflicting information) when they anticipated having to refute unterarguments. In contrast, highly confident groups demonstrated a strong confirmation bias independent of the anticipated task requirements

    Reference values of impulse oscillometric lung function indices in adults of advanced age.

    Get PDF
    Impulse oscillometry (IOS) is a non-demanding lung function test. Its diagnostic use may be particularly useful in patients of advanced age with physical or mental limitations unable to perform spirometry. Only few reference equations are available for Caucasians, none of them covering the old age. Here, we provide reference equations up to advanced age and compare them with currently available equations. IOS was performed in a population-based sample of 1990 subjects, aged 45-91 years, from KORA cohorts (Augsburg, Germany). From those, 397 never-smoking, lung healthy subjects with normal spirometry were identified and sex-specific quantile regression models with age, height and body weight as predictors for respiratory system impedance, resistance, reactance, and other parameters of IOS applied. Women (n = 243) showed higher resistance values than men (n = 154), while reactance at low frequencies (up to 20 Hz) was lower (p<0.05). A significant age dependency was observed for the difference between resistance values at 5 Hz and 20 Hz (R5-R20), the integrated area of low-frequency reactance (AX), and resonant frequency (Fres) in both sexes whereas reactance at 5 Hz (X5) was age dependent only in females. In the healthy subjects (n = 397), mean differences between observed values and predictions for resistance (5 Hz and 20 Hz) and reactance (5 Hz) ranged between -1% and 5% when using the present model. In contrast, differences based on the currently applied equations (Vogel & Smidt 1994) ranged between -34% and 76%. Regarding our equations the indices were beyond the limits of normal in 8.1% to 18.6% of the entire KORA cohort (n = 1990), and in 0.7% to 9.4% with the currently applied equations. Our study provides up-to-date reference equations for IOS in Caucasians aged 45 to 85 years. We suggest the use of the present equations particularly in advanced age in order to detect airway dysfunction

    Rentabilität vegetabiler Düngemittel im ökologischen Gemüsebau am Beispiel eines süddeutschen Gemischtbetriebes

    Get PDF
    For a given organic farm with livestock and vegetable production in Southern Germany the economic viability of on farm produced legume seed meal as Plant Based Organic Fertiliser (PBOF) is analysed by means of a Linear Programming (LP) model in order to asses under which conditions such a fertiliser use may be profitable. Yields, labour demand and gross margins of the different farming activities are taken from data collections and adapted based on information provided by the farmer, whose specific crop rotation, labour and stable restrictions are also implemented in the LP model. Nitrogen supplies and demands of the different farming activities are drawn from data collections and information by plant scientists. Our calculations show that legume seed meal as PBOF is profitable in case that cheap purchasable organic nitrogen fertilisers are not available. In future, further model calculations shall show whether this result also holds for other farming and site conditions than those underlying the quite specific conditions of our model farm

    Inkubationsversuche zum Einfluss von Sorte und Textur auf den Umsatz von Lupinenkörnerschroten im Boden bei unterschiedlichen Temperaturen

    Get PDF
    Organically produced legume seed meals are an upcoming alternative to established fast mineralising organic fertilisers based on plant and animal waste products with suspect origin (e.g. hornmeal). The turnover in soil was investigated with respect to the influence of legume variety and seed meal texture. Variety specific differences in net N mineralisation could be attributed to differences in C/N ratio and cellulose content. The influence of texture classes on net N mineralisation was considerably smaller than the influence of differences between the investigated species

    Social validation in group decision making: differential effects on the decisional impact of preference-consistent and preference-inconsistent information

    Full text link
    "Shared information has a stronger impact on group decisions than unshared information. A prominent explanation for this phenomenon is that shared information can be socially validated during group discussion and, hence, is perceived as more accurate and relevant than unshared information. In the present study we argue that this explanation only holds for preference-inconsistent information (i.e., information contradicting the group members’ initial preferences) but not for preference-consistent information. In Experiments 1 and 2 participants studied the protocol of a fictitious group discussion. In this protocol, we manipulated which types of information were socially validated. As predicted, social validation increased the decisional impact of preference-inconsistent but not preference-consistent information. In both experiments the effect of social validation was mediated by the perceived quality of information. Experiment 3 replicated the results of the first two experiments in an interactive setting in which two confederates discussed a decision case face-to-face with one participant." [author's abstract
